
Just 2 days ago, I mentioned I found a service that can generate RSS feeds into short articles using JavaScript. Then ShaolinTiger shared his idea of using PHP to perform the same trick. So, I decided to try it out, and as you can notice I’ve just integrated a few more news feed from different sources into my blog (in the sidebar on your right
).
I will still blog for the latest tech news as usual, but now you are able to read more than that, including the following :-
- Technology News
Feeds of the latest gadget information/news from Engadget, Gizmodo & Wired News. - General News
Feeds from Google Top News, Yahoo Top News & Reuters. - Corporate News
Latest blog entries from various corporate blogs such as Google Blog, Yahoo Search Blog & Internet Explorer (IE) Blog from Microsoft.
I’ll add in more news sources from time to time to enrich my blog and wish to provide you all a one stop place for latest tech news.
